On Monday 18th April, we will welcome local rivals, Grays Athletic to Park Lane as we compete in the Pitching In Isthmian North Division, kick-off 3pm. This is our final scheduled home match of the 2021/22 season.
This has all the ingredients to be a thrilling encounter. Just 2 games remain and we currently sit in 2nd position, and we will be aiming to stay there so that we have home advantage in the forthcoming playoffs. Meanwhile, Grays Athletic sit just 1 point outside of the playoff places, so they'll be fighting to break into those places.
The two sides have already met this season when we triumphed 3-1 away from home.
We come into this match following a 1-1 draw away to Great Wakering Rovers on Saturday afternoon. Meanwhile, Grays Athletic lost 2-0 to fellow playoff hopefuls, Brentwood Town.
